Get in Touch** The Volvo repair market for residents of Chickamauga, GA, is almost entirely reliant on the neighboring city of Chattanooga, TN, located approximately 20-30 minutes away. There are no Volvo-specific specialists or a franchised Volvo dealership within Chickamauga itself. The market in the broader region is characterized by a few high-quality, independent European auto specialists who compete directly with the franchised dealership (Mountain View Volvo, also in Chattanooga). The independent shops listed have carved out a strong reputation by offering dealer-level expertise at a more competitive labor rate. Typical pricing for independent specialists ranges from $120-$150/hour, significantly lower than dealership rates, while still providing access to OEM parts and advanced diagnostics. Competition is healthy, driving a focus on customer service and technical excellence, which benefits Volvo owners in the area. For the most advanced hybrid/Recharge system diagnostics and calibrations, the franchised dealer is often the primary destination, but the top independials like C&S Auto are fully capable of handling these systems.

Given our local climate with hot, humid summers, Volvo cooling system components like radiators and thermostats are common failure points. Additionally, the rural roads and occasional rough terrain around Chickamauga and Walker County can lead to more frequent wear on suspension components, tires, and wheel alignments on Volvo SUVs and sedans.
Since Chickamauga is a smaller town, you may need to look at nearby areas like LaFayette, Fort Oglethorpe, or Chattanooga for specialized service. Look for shops that are Volvo-specific or European auto specialists, and check for certifications like ASE, along with strong online reviews that mention long-term Volvo expertise.
Yes, specialized Volvo repair typically carries a premium due to the need for specific tools, software, and training. However, using a qualified independent specialist in the North Georgia area is often significantly more cost-effective than a dealership, while still providing the correct diagnostics and OEM-quality parts.
Immediately seek a local diagnostic if you see critical warnings like the check engine light flashing, low oil pressure, or overheating, as continuing to drive could cause severe damage. For non-critical alerts, a qualified local European shop in the Chattanooga region can properly read Volvo-specific codes and advise on the urgency.
The high pollen count and seasonal humidity can clog cabin air filters and air intake systems quickly, so more frequent filter changes are advised. Also, preparing your Volvo's battery and cooling system for our hot summers and checking undercarriage seals after driving on gravel or dirt country roads is prudent for long-term reliability.
